Antidepressants are often used to treat IBS.
The gut wall has its own collection of brain cells embedded in it and it works independently to the head brain.
That's why the gut continues working when someone's head brain is comprised or even brain dead.
Antidepressants calm those cells and relieve IBS symptoms.
